A passageway with double columns, Sintra National Palace, Sintra, Portugal, 2009. The National Palace of Sintra is a multi-storeyed national monument that portrays architectural styles from the 13th to the 19th centuries. It features elements of Gothic, Mudejar, Manueline and Renaissance architecture, along with wonderful azulejos (coloured glazed tiles) from the 15th and 16th centuries in various halls and patios and in the Royal Chapel.
